>Sure, you can install MSDE on an XP Pro or W2K Pro box, but you're limited to 10 connections to it so you can't reach the 20 users JD claims can be reasonably supported.

10 connections?? Oh really? That is news to me. Would you mind telling me where you're getting your information about 10 connections from? BOL clearly states that

"A concurrent workload governor limits the performance of the database engine in the Desktop Edition (MSDE). The performance of individual Transact-SQL batches is decreased when more than five batches are executed concurrently. The amount each batch is slowed down depends on how many batches over the five-batch limit are executing concurrently, and the amount of data retrieved by the individual batches. As more batches are executed concurrently, and as more data is retrieved by each batch, the more the governor slows down the individual batches. You can use the DBCC CONCURRENCYVIOLATION statement to report how often the concurrent workload governor is activated."

I'm not seeing anything about 10 connections anywhere.
